    TIPS

    - Always supervise your cat while eating bones or longer lasting chews.

    - Do not feed if your cat has broken or damaged teeth.

    - Due to the higher natural fat content of these chews, they are not recommended for overweight cats or cats suffering from pancreatitis.

    - When feeding your cat dehydrated raw or raw meaty bones, always feed every second to third day, to allow for proper digestion of the bone content.
